Ordinals
beta
Sat 1273037030101998
decimal
299214.2030101998
degree
0°89214′846″2030101998‴
percentile
60.620811023920915%
name
evgzyetxfmx
cycle
0
epoch
1
period
148
block
299214
offset
2030101998
timestamp
2014-05-05 14:03:40 UTC
rarity
common
prev
next